При первичной инициализации, читается "девятый" сектор, в котором лежит информация для работы с дискетой. Не происходит позиционирования на 0 дорожку, либо сами данные не приходят (было такое при неисправности "обвязки" контроллера бета диска).
Вид для печати
При первичной инициализации, читается "девятый" сектор, в котором лежит информация для работы с дискетой. Не происходит позиционирования на 0 дорожку, либо сами данные не приходят (было такое при неисправности "обвязки" контроллера бета диска).
Аккуратно пальцами подвигать голову чуть вперед назад ,без усилий и нажатий ,и держа только за твердые части. Если начнет читать ,то головы сбиты юстировать.
Но как вижу привод с шаговиком на винтовой передаче ,они редко сбиваются. Глянуть осциллографом ,что на выходе данных с дисковода ,и вообще как они до ВГ93 добираются.
- - - Добавлено - - -
И еще это не HD дисковод ? если HD/DD ,то смотреть перемычки конфигурации.
А вот подскажет ли мне кто о такой проблеме с дисководом?
Собрал новодел BDI+AY для Дельта-С..Все вроде как работает, однако дисковод 3.5 на нем чудит славно..
При форматировании/чтении дискеты, головы стартуют с начальной дорожки и доходят до конца, вроде как и должно быть.
Далее TRDOS вываливает *error*..После ресета БПК головы не возвращаются обратно на 0, стоят в том же положении..Соответственно, при вводе новой команды просто дуплят в последнем положении гуляя туда сюда..Только после(передергивания питания)возвращаются на место..На что грешить? Пока подозрение на ВГ93, ибо изначально тестил контроллер без питания 12В на ВГ..Хотя судя по схеме, имеется защита при его пропадании..ВГшка как вообще тестится? Ну или логику потребушить?
P.S. Дисководы пробовал разные..В арсенале их пол тележки..
https://i.ibb.co/TtCHRs4/tmp-cam-470...7591488503.jpg
Если на RESET(19) ВГшки приходит 0, то она производит сброс, к-й включает в себя возврат головки на 0 дорожку, для этого она должна выставить сигнал DIR(16)=0 для и до 256 коротких импульсов STEP(15), пока TRACK00(34) не станет равным 0. Смотрите прохождение сигналов на дисковод, DIR, в первую очередь. На дисководе сигналы инверсные.
Напрямую RESET не замыкайте! Обычно сброс ВГ происходит при ресете спека.
Отстроил оба дисковода. Читают одинаково. Теперь пойду в другую тему. Не могу заставить их работать вместе
У вас контроллер турбированный? Попробуйте на фиксированной частоте 1 МГц.
Тогда откуда на ВГшке 2 МГц ?
Должно быть 1 МГц.
Может, контакт висячий где-то в делителе частоты.
Быть может контроллер под 2 типа дисководов? 2Мгц для 8", 1Мгц под 5.25"
Вопрос почему частота так плавает после опроса дисковода? Первым делом проверил делитель, вроде все на месте..Кварц стоит на 8Мгц, значит как то делит на две частоты..Да и 2Мгц стабильная до переключения